The Current State of Domain Name Regulation: Domain Names as Second Class Citizens in a Mark-Dominated World - Routledge Research in Information Technology and E-Commerce Law
Komaitis, Konstantinos (University of Strathclyde, UK)
This book evaluates the behaviour of domain names within the rule of law as well as their regulatory frameworks. Drawing on experience from various jurisdictions, the book determines the property nature of domain names, and suggests solutions as to how the regulation of domain names can be reformed.
